Pilot Shortage May Force Skywest To Halt Essential Air Service In 29 Cities
The EAS program was launched to guarantee that small communities were served by certified air carriers, according to the U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T). EAS ensures that 115 cities, in 48 different states, receive scheduled air service they normally wouldn’t receive from bigger air carriers. SkyWest Airlines gave its 90-day notice to the DOT of its intent to discontinue service to 29 cities. All 29 of those airports are served by United Airlines, with SkyWest as the carrier....
